Summary
Confirming his intentions to leave for Monticello "on Monday next;" saying "altho' I have no actual head-ach, yet about 9. o'clock every morning I have a very quickened pulse come on, a disturbed head & tender eyes, not amounting to absolute pain. it goes off about noon, and is doubtless an obstinate remnant of the head-ach, keeping up a possibility of return. I am not very confident of it passing off."
